Downspout Trenching in Houston, TX
Downspout trenching services involve excavating trenches to properly redirect rainwater away from a property's foundation. This process is commonly used when existing downspouts need to be extended or when new drainage pathways are required to prevent water pooling around the home. Property owners often request this service for projects such as installing underground drainage systems, repairing or replacing damaged downspouts, or managing water flow in areas prone to erosion or flooding. Understanding the scope of trenching, including the length and depth needed, as well as the landscape features, can help homeowners plan for effective water management solutions.
Before requesting downspout trenching, property owners should consider the layout of their drainage system and any existing underground utilities that may be affected. It is also helpful to identify areas where water tends to collect or cause damage, so the trenching can be tailored to address those issues. Clear communication about the property's landscape, drainage goals, and any obstacles will assist in designing a trenching plan that effectively directs water away from the foundation and reduces potential water-related problems.

Downspout Trenching Questions
What is downspout trenching? Downspout trenching involves digging a narrow channel to redirect rainwater away from the foundation and prevent water damage.
Why is trenching necessary for downspouts? Trenching helps ensure proper drainage, reducing the risk of basement flooding and soil erosion around the property.
What types of projects require downspout trenching? Projects typically include installing new drainage systems, replacing damaged sections, or extending existing downspouts for better water management.
How does trenching improve property drainage? Proper trenching directs rainwater away from the foundation and landscaping, helping to maintain soil stability and prevent pooling around the home.
